服务器2核2G最佳系统选择指南
结论:对于2核2G配置的服务器,推荐使用轻量级Linux发行版(如AlmaLinux、Rocky Linux、Debian或Ubuntu Server),避免Windows Server以减少资源占用,并确保系统优化以提升性能。
1. 系统选择的核心考量因素
- 资源占用:2核2G属于低配服务器,需选择轻量级系统,避免资源浪费。
- 稳定性与兼容性:优先选择长期支持(LTS)版本,确保安全更新和软件生态支持。
- 用途:Web服务器、数据库、轻量应用等不同场景可能影响系统选择。
2. 推荐的操作系统及适用场景
(1)Linux发行版(最佳选择)
- AlmaLinux/Rocky Linux(CentOS替代方案)
- 优势:稳定、企业级支持,适合生产环境。
- 适用场景:Web服务器(Nginx/Apache)、数据库(MySQL/PostgreSQL)。
- Debian
- 优势:极低资源占用,软件包丰富,社区支持强。
- 适用场景:轻量级应用、Docker/Kubernetes环境。
- Ubuntu Server LTS
- 优势:易用性强,文档丰富,适合新手。
- 适用场景:通用服务器、云计算(AWS/Azure兼容性好)。
关键点:如果追求极致性能,选择Debian;如果需要企业级支持,选择AlmaLinux/Rocky Linux。
(2)Windows Server(不推荐)
- 缺点:
- 内存占用高(仅系统可能消耗1GB+),2G内存易导致卡顿。
- 需要授权费用,成本较高。
- 仅适用场景:必须运行.NET或特定Windows软件的情况。
3. 优化建议(提升2核2G服务器性能)
- 禁用图形界面:Linux服务器建议仅用命令行模式(如Ubuntu Server或Debian minimal)。
- 使用轻量级服务:
- Web服务器:Nginx > Apache(更省内存)。
- 数据库:SQLite或MariaDB(比MySQL更轻量)。
- 启用Swap分区:避免内存不足导致崩溃(但会牺牲部分磁盘性能)。
- 定期更新:确保系统补丁和安全更新,避免资源被恶意占用。
4. 总结
- 首选Linux:AlmaLinux/Rocky Linux(企业级)、Debian(极简)、Ubuntu Server(易用)。
- 避免Windows:除非有强制需求,否则不推荐。
- 优化是关键:2核2G的服务器必须精简系统,合理分配资源,否则容易性能瓶颈。
根据实际需求选择系统,并做好优化,即使是低配服务器也能稳定运行中小型应用。
秒懂云